About TSO: Paul O'Neill founded Trans-Siberian Orchestra with the vision "to create a progressive rock band that would push boundaries further than any group before." With more than 10 million albums sold and having played live to over 15 million people, TSO has inspired generations of fans to rediscover the multi-dimensional art form of the rock opera and has become one of the world's top touring acts in the process.
